Modes of crossed rectangular waveguide
Summary
Summary
The cutoff frequencies and model fields of dually polarized crossed rectangular waveguide are calculated numerically and the cutoff frequencies verified experimentally. Symmetry arguments and group theory are used to explain mode degeneracies and mode splitting. The single mode bandwidth is 38 percent of center frequency for both polarization when the...

DABS link performance considerations
Summary
Summary
The DABS link performance is computed using the present values for the system operating parameters and the available models that describe environment and aircraft antenna effects. The various fade mechanisms are described, and a statistical determination of performance is proposed. The performance is computed for various sets of conditions including...
Scale model pattern measurements of aircraft L-band beacon antennas
Summary
Summary
This report describes the techniques and apparatus used to measure the directional patterns of aircraft ATC transponder antennas (L-Band) using digital techniques and magnetic tapes for data storage. Algorithms involved in data normalization, cross-polarization correction and coordinate conversations are discussed. Some typical applications of the data are illustrated with actual...
An analysis of aircraft L-band beacon antenna patterns
Summary
Summary
Radiation patterns are examined for L-Band beacon antennas mounted on aircraft ranging from small, single-engine, general aviation aircraft to the Boeing 747. The data analyzed consists of antenna gain values taken in two degree steps over a spherical surface centered at the antenna location. Data from three representative scale model...
Summary of results of antenna design cost studies
Summary
Summary
Design/cost studies on antenna systems for DABS have been carried out by Texas Instruments and Westinghouse under Lincoln Laboratory sponsorship. For independent, mechanically-rotating systems aperture widths between 10' and 35' and heights between 4' and 16' were considered, with estimated corresponding production costs ranging from $10K to more than $200K...

Final Report: Transponder Test Program
Summary
Summary
Performance parameters of transponders installed in aircraft were measured to determine their degree of compliance with current specifications. A mobile van was outfitted with electronic test equipment which simulated the transmitter and receiver sections of a ground interrogator and which allowed measurement of transponder parameters.
